Since childhood I have had a love affair with the mystical aspects of life, the otherworldly and the sacred forces in nature. Growing up in rural Sweden I noticed that spending time in the woods, as well as being absorbed in a creative process could stop my loneliness and satisfy my intense longing for connection. I suspect it was because both these activities brought me into the grace of the present moment so I could fully experience the aliveness running through me and thereby get a sense of being held and part of Creation. Image making is now something of a spiritual practice for me. I paint in oil, acrylic and make images out of yarn and fabric. I listen to little whispers and inner impulses as I work and when something gets my heart activated I go for it. Unless it is a commission for someone else I generally do not spend much time sketching out the piece beforehand. I may have an overall idea of my intentions, but I enjoy being surprised by what appears and happens along the way and what wants to come through me. Life, as I see it, is a rich mystery to be lived rather than a problem to be solved. My wish is for my artwork to reflect that.
